Output 12e86d10e004dc7c46758869b690507632bcb4112cad5bae3ea55e19e44ed8d9:19

value
71601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b42c4fb80d6c763b5ca0946ada17a3a8832c2f1 OP_EQUAL
address
38Yxb9vRsfEcGyeDirJBbw4Pk9JUJDXtu8
transaction
12e86d10e004dc7c46758869b690507632bcb4112cad5bae3ea55e19e44ed8d9
confirmations
271693
spent
true